如何查找npm模块的存储路径和服务器地址?

在当今的软件开发领域,使用npm(Node Package Manager)进行模块管理和依赖关系处理已经成为了一种普遍的做法。然而,对于开发者来说,了解npm模块的存储路径和服务器地址是非常重要的。这不仅有助于我们更好地管理和维护项目,还能提高开发效率。那么,如何查找npm模块的存储路径和服务器地址呢?本文将为您详细介绍。

一、npm模块存储路径

npm模块的存储路径主要分为两种:本地路径和全局路径。

  1. 本地路径

本地路径指的是当前项目中的node_modules目录。该目录下存储了项目依赖的所有npm模块。要查找本地路径,可以通过以下步骤进行:

  • 打开终端或命令提示符。
  • 输入npm root -g命令,查看全局路径。
  • 切换到项目目录,输入npm root命令,查看本地路径。

  1. 全局路径

全局路径指的是系统范围内的node_modules目录。该目录下存储了所有npm模块,包括全局安装的模块。要查找全局路径,可以通过以下步骤进行:

  • 打开终端或命令提示符。
  • 输入npm root -g命令,查看全局路径。

二、npm模块服务器地址

npm模块的服务器地址是指存放npm模块的远程仓库地址。默认情况下,npm使用的是官方仓库地址:https://registry.npmjs.org/。以下是如何查找和修改npm模块服务器地址的方法:

  1. 查看当前服务器地址

    • 打开终端或命令提示符。
    • 输入npm config get registry命令,查看当前服务器地址。
  2. 修改服务器地址

    • 打开终端或命令提示符。
    • 输入npm config set registry [新地址]命令,将地址修改为新服务器地址。

三、案例分析

以下是一个简单的案例分析,展示如何查找npm模块的存储路径和服务器地址:

  1. 查找本地路径

    • 假设当前项目目录为/Users/user/project
    • 打开终端,切换到项目目录:cd /Users/user/project
    • 输入npm root命令,查看本地路径:/Users/user/project/node_modules
  2. 查找全局路径

    • 打开终端,输入npm root -g命令,查看全局路径:/usr/local/lib/node_modules
  3. 查看当前服务器地址

    • 打开终端,输入npm config get registry命令,查看当前服务器地址:https://registry.npmjs.org/
  4. 修改服务器地址

    • 打开终端,输入npm config set registry https://registry.npm.taobao.org/命令,将地址修改为淘宝镜像地址。

通过以上步骤,您可以轻松地查找npm模块的存储路径和服务器地址,从而更好地管理和维护您的项目。

总结

本文详细介绍了如何查找npm模块的存储路径和服务器地址。了解这些信息对于开发者来说至关重要,它有助于我们更好地管理和维护项目,提高开发效率。希望本文能对您有所帮助。

猜你喜欢:OpenTelemetry